4. Setup Guide

Follow these steps to set up your VSVABEFV R816US router for the first time.

4.1. SIM Card and Battery Installation

  1. Remove the back cover of the router.
  2. If present, remove the insulating sheet from the battery compartment.
  3. Insert your Mini SIM card into the designated SIM card slot. Ensure it is correctly oriented and makes good contact. (Note: Only Mini SIM cards are supported. Standard and Nano SIM cards are not compatible.)
    Diagram showing correct Mini SIM card type and incorrect Standard and Nano SIM card types.

    Figure 4.1: Supported SIM Card Type

  4. Insert the provided Lithium battery into its compartment.
  5. Replace the back cover securely.

4.2. Initial Power On and Connection

Press and hold the power button on the router until the screen lights up. The device will display a 'Welcome' message and then show network status indicators. The default Wi-Fi SSID and password will be displayed on the device screen (e.g., SSID: LTE-XXXX, KEY: 12345678).

4.3. Accessing the Web Management Interface

To configure advanced settings, access the router's web management interface:

  1. Connect your computer or mobile device to the router's Wi-Fi network using the default SSID and password shown on the router's screen.
  2. Open a web browser and enter the default IP address: 192.168.0.1
  3. When prompted, enter the default username: admin and default password: admin.

4.4. Configuring APN Settings (If Needed)

If your SIM card is not plug-and-play, you may need to manually configure the APN (Access Point Name).

  1. After logging into the web interface, navigate to the 'Internet' tab.
  2. Click on 'Internet Connection' or 'APN' settings.
  3. If the automatically read APN is incorrect, or if there's no internet connection, you may need to manually add a new APN profile. Select 'Manual' for Connection Mode.
  4. Click 'Add New' or similar option to enter your SIM card's specific APN details (APN Name, Username, Password, Authentication Type). This information is usually provided by your mobile carrier.
  5. Ensure the 'Auto APN' option is disabled if you are manually configuring.
  6. Save the settings.

4.5. Changing Wi-Fi Network Name (SSID) and Password

For security, it is recommended to change the default Wi-Fi SSID and password.

  1. In the web management interface, navigate to the 'Wireless' tab.
  2. Click on 'Wireless Security Settings'.
  3. Modify the 'Network Name (SSID)' to your preferred name.
  4. Enter a strong, unique password in the 'Password' field.
  5. Click 'Save' to apply the changes. You will need to reconnect your devices using the new Wi-Fi credentials.

5.1. Connecting Devices

The router can share Wi-Fi with up to 10 users simultaneously within a 50-meter range. Simply search for the Wi-Fi network on your smartphone, tablet, laptop, or smart TV, and enter the correct password to connect.

5.2. Battery Life

The router is equipped with a 2400mAh Lithium battery, providing approximately 6 hours of continuous usage depending on network conditions and the number of connected devices.

7.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ues with your router, refer to the following common problems and solutions:

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
No Internet ConnectionSIM card not activated, incorrect APN settings, roaming disabled, virtual SIM/IoT SIM.Ensure SIM card is active and supports data. Disable PIN code. Verify and modify APN settings via the web interface (192.168.0.1 > Network > APN). Ensure roaming service is enabled if traveling internationally. Note: Virtual SIM and IoT SIM cards are not supported.
Slow Network SpeedNetwork mode not optimized, weak signal.In web interface (Internet tab), confirm 'Preferred LTE Type' is set to 'TD-LTE preferred' or '4G Preferred' for optimal speed. Move to an area with better signal strength.
Device Not Powering OnBattery not charged, insulating sheet not removed.Charge the device using the provided USB cable. Ensure the insulating sheet on the battery contacts has been removed during installation.
Cannot Connect to Wi-FiIncorrect password, Wi-Fi disabled.Verify the Wi-Fi password. Check Wi-Fi settings in the web interface to ensure Wi-Fi is enabled.
